To effectively monitor and control expenses and revenue, regularly track financial statements such as profit and loss reports and cash flow statements. Implement budgeting practices to set spending limits and analyze variances between budgeted and actual figures. Utilize accounting software for real-time data analysis and reporting, enabling timely decision-making. Additionally, conduct periodic reviews to identify trends and areas for improvement in financial performance.
